You are not logged in.
Pages: 1
the lx desktop environment does not work well without fam.
Maybe fam should be added as dependency?
Offline
In fact, you'd like to replace fam by gamin.
See: http://wiki.lxde.org/en/ArchLinux
Last edited by cwjiof (2008-09-27 11:46:28)
Offline
This is nice and cool, but you can install lxde with nor fam nor gamin. Isn't this a problem?
Probably lxde should have fam as dep and gamin should replace fam.
Offline
Can someone give a quick comparison of gamin vs fam?
My Arch Linux Stuff • Forum Etiquette • Community Ethos - Arch is not for everyone
Offline
Can someone give a quick comparison of gamin vs fam?
http://www.gnome.org/~veillard/gamin/overview.html
From my personal experience, gamin is far less prone to race conditions between threads than fam. gamin should be enough to do anything that's needed to be done; inotify covers everything else.
Offline
Thanks, skottish.
My Arch Linux Stuff • Forum Etiquette • Community Ethos - Arch is not for everyone
Offline
Well? The packages will be updated somewhat?
Offline
I doubt fam/gamin will be added as a dependency as it is not needed to run lxde. It just adds some nice features. Perhaps it would be good to add it as an optdepend to lxde-common. File a feature request and see what the maintainer thinks.
Online
Well, I noticed I was lacking fam/gamin because the lxde split a huge error message just after starting... It works more or less after, but it did not seem really optional. I'll file a feature request.
Last edited by ezzetabi (2008-09-28 15:42:23)
Offline
fam (or gamin) is already a dependency of pcmanfm which is lxde's default file manager.
Offline
But I cannot find gamin in the dependencies.
[~] % pacman -Qi pcmanfm
Name : pcmanfm
Version : 0.5-2
URL : http://pcmanfm.sourceforge.net/
Licenses : GPL
Groups : lxde
Provides : None
Depends On : gtk2 hal fam startup-notification shared-mime-info desktop-file-utils
Optional Deps : None
Required By : None
Conflicts With : None
Replaces : None
Installed Size : 1192.00 K
Packager : Geoffroy Carrier <geoffroy.carrier@koon.fr>
Architecture : i686
Build Date : 2008.09.20 (Sat) 13:39:37
Install Date : 2008.09.20 (Sat) 15:10:48
Install Reason : Explicitly installed
Install Script : Yes
Description : File manager of the LXDE Desktop
Last edited by cwjiof (2008-09-28 17:12:43)
Offline
[skottish@iasE ~]$ pacman -Qi gamin
Name : gamin
Version : 0.1.9-4
URL : http://www.gnome.org/~veillard/gamin
Licenses : GPL
Groups : None
Provides : fam
Depends On : glib2
Optional Deps : None
Required By : gnome-vfs pcmanfm
Conflicts With : fam
Replaces : None
Installed Size : 195.94 K
Packager : Abhishek Dasgupta <abhidg@gmail.com>
Architecture : x86_64
Build Date : Mon 28 Jul 2008 06:18:26 AM PDT
Install Date : Fri 01 Aug 2008 05:43:51 PM PDT
Install Reason : Explicitly installed
Install Script : No
Description : Gamin is a file and directory monitoring system defined to be a
subset of the FAM (File Alteration Monitor) system.
gamin provides fam.
Offline
Pages: 1